What’s for Dinner? Try this easy, cheap dish: Nacho Beef Skillet 
1 lb. lean ground beef or Turkey
1 1/2 cups water
1 (14.5-oz.) can diced tomatoes with mild green chiles, undrained
1 (11-oz.) can Mexicorn® Whole Kernel Corn, Red and Green Peppers, drained (we use frozen corn)
1 (4.4-oz.) envelope Spanish rice mix
6 oz. (1 1/2 cups) shredded Mexican cheese blend
Corn Tortilla Chips (Or Nachos or a Bed of Shredded lettuce!)
sliced green onions for garnish
Steps
1 Brown ground beef in large skillet over medium-high heat until thoroughly cooked, stirring frequently.
Drain.
2 Add water, tomatoes, corn and rice mix; mix well. Reduce heat to low;
cover and cook 10 to 15 minutes or until rice is tender.
3 Stir in 1 cup of the cheese until melted. Add nachos (or doritos!) on serving plate, sprinkle
with remaining 1/2 cup cheese and top with meat mixture
